Currently...if you enter on an e-Visa (electronic online Tourist Visa) from evisa.gov.kh , or a T-type (Tourist) Visa (yes - they are available) issued by a Cambodian Embassy/Consulate, then you can apply for 1x 30 day Extension of Stay only, giving a total period of stay up to 2 months max.garthkiddell wrote: ↑Thu Nov 04, 2021 3:03 pm what gets me if you go too all that trouble to come can you get a e long term visa ?
i've heard the internet e visatravel is avail , but thats short term, and theres no tourist visa
unless you have a retirement visa already ,you could be wasting money.
Once land borders reopen and VOA's are available again, it will be possible for you, or your passport, to go on a Visa run to get an E-type (Ordinary) Visa which will allow you to apply for a long term Extension of Stay.
Who knows what will happen in the next month or 2, there is likely be more easing of the current restrictions, so if you want to stay long term but are unable to obtain an E-type (Ordinary/Business) Visa, then I suggest you wait to see what happens.
